6 / 12 page 11/2/04 Page 6 of 12 © 2004 Fairchild Semiconductor Corporation HIGH SPEED TRANSISTOR OPTOCOUPLERS SINGLE-CHANNEL: 6N135 6N136 HCPL-2503 HCPL-4502 DUAL-CHANNEL: HCPL-2530 HCPL-2531 Notes 1. Derate linearly above 70°C free-air temperature at a rate of 0.8 mA/°C. 2. Derate linearly above 70°C free-air temperature at a rate of 1.6 mA/°C. 3. Derate linearly above 70°C free-air temperature at a rate of 0.9 mW/°C. 4. Derate linearly above 70°C free-air temperature at a rate of 2.0 mW/°C. 5. Current Transfer Ratio is defined as a ratio of output collector current, IO, to the forward LED input current, IF, times 100%. 6. The 4.1 k Ω load represents 1 LSTTL unit load of 0.36 mA and 6.1kΩ pull-up resistor. 7. The 1.9 k Ω load represents 1 TTL unit load of 1.6 mA and 5.6 kΩ pull-up resistor. 8. Common mode transient immunity in logic high level is the maximum tolerable (positive) dVcm/dt on the leading edge of the common mode pulse signal VCM, to assure that the output will remain in a logic high state (i.e., VO>2.0 V). Common mode transient immunity in logic low level is the maximum tolerable (negative) dVcm/dt on the trailing edge of the common mode pulse signal, VCM, to assure that the output will remain in a logic low state (i.e., VO<0.8 V). 9. Device is considered a two terminal device: Pins 1, 2, 3 and 4 are shorted together and Pins 5, 6, 7 and 8 are shorted together. 10. Measured between pins 1 and 2 shorted together, and pins 3 and 4 shorted together.
